Thread: How configure Oracle 9i not case sensitive...
Hi, i would configure Oracle 9i not case sensitive and in the table names dont use ""... How can i do this ? Thanks in advance
Eloy Mier Pérez wrote: > How can i do this ? Not possible. Oracle works upper-case only for dictionary unless using "". Many have found this to be "a good thing", others think it's a limitation.
